Surface Disposal

ONGC Mehsana Asset

 

Capacity: 500 KLD | Duration: 3 Years | Model: BOO (Build-Own-Operate)

We implemented a comprehensive wastewater treatment solution for ONGC’s Mehsana Asset under a long-term BOO service model. The system integrates advanced technologies including Tilted Plate Interceptor (TPI), Tiny Bubble Floatation, Oxidation, Rapid Settling, Pressure Sand Filtration, SiC-Ceramic Membranes, and RO.

The project ensures complete compliance with disposal norms by consistently achieving zero turbidity, TSS, O&G, and reducing TDS from 15,000 mg/L to <250 mg/L.

Subsurface Disposal

ONGC Cambay Asset

 

Capacity: 300 KLD | Duration: 7 Years | Scope: EPC + O&M

Delivered a complete turnkey solution for subsurface wastewater disposal at ONGC’s Cambay Asset. The project covered design, engineering, manufacturing, supply, installation, and long-term O&M, ensuring reliable performance and regulatory compliance.

The treatment train featured Tilted Plate Interceptor (TPI), Tiny Bubble Floatation, and SiC-Ceramic Membrane System, achieving significant reductions in O&G and TSS levels.

✅ Performance Highlights: Reduced O&G from 50–220 mg/L to <10 ppm and TSS from 100–200 mg/L to <100 ppm.

ZLD Reject Management System

Advanced Effluent Treatment
 

Capacity: 300 KLD | Scope: Next-Gen Evaporation & Filtration

Engineered and deployed a Zero Liquid Discharge (ZLD) solution integrating advanced evaporation and filtration technologies for efficient reject management. The system included a 4-Effect Forced Circulation MEE, Ceramic Membrane Filtration Unit (1 No.), and ATFD (Vertical & Horizontal, 1800 kg/hr × 2) to ensure reliable recovery and disposal.
